BC Métis Federation Development Corporation Project Approved

(Vancouver, BC) BC Métis Federation leadership is implementing a number of strategic initiatives to enhance the future of the organization, members, and partner communities. One of the key BC Métis Federation priorities has been the implementation of an economic development strategy which includes the establishment of a development corporation.

BC Métis Federation has been approved by the Tale’awtxw Aboriginal Capital Corporation (TACC) for the development of a business plan and financial statements for the development corporation. TACC has approved funding under their Business Equity Program. A consulting firm has been identified to support the project and BC Métis Federation will be providing 25% of the total project costs.

BC Métis Federation President Keith Henry stated, “Thank you to TACC for the support. TACC is one of a number of Aboriginal capital corporations in British Columbia who assist Métis and all Aboriginal communities and entrepreneurs. Our board will be meeting in November to initiate the project and review support for completion from the identified consulting firm of Brian Payer and Associates.”

BC Métis Federation President Henry concluded, “This is a very important project to establish an economic development entity. The BC Métis Federation Development Corporation will ensure strong corporate governance, support members and their businesses, mitigate liabilities for future economic initiatives, and separate politics from economic project opportunities. Having a business plan to present to members, entrepreneurs and partners is important. I look forward to the future work together with our board, consultant and members. BC Métis Federation continues to increase support and recognition of our important work.”
